Characterization of pesticide exposure in agricultural workers of banana plantations in Barú, Chiriquí

Introduction: In Panama, information regarding the occupational exposure of agricultural workers to pesticides and the protective measures they use remains limited and outdated.
Objectives: To characterize pesticide exposure among workers on banana farms in the corregimiento of Baco, district of Barú, Chiriquí, during 2024.
Methods: Descriptive, cross-sectional study with a non-probabilistic sample of 48 farmers. Data were collected through a structured questionnaire on demographic variables, frequency and type of pesticides, exposure time, use of personal protective equipment, safety practices, and waste disposal. Analysis was performed using descriptive statistics in Microsoft Excel.
Results: Study participants were male, with a mean age of 51.2 years. About 66.7% were exposed 3–4 times per workday, and more than half applied pesticides several times per week. A total of 39.6% reported 21–30 years of work with these products. The most commonly used pesticides were glyphosate, Gramoxone, Counter, and Vydate, some of which are restricted in Panama. Although 89.6% reported using PPE, gloves, goggles, and overalls were infrequently used. Only one-third had received prior training. Handling of empty containers included burning, burying, or reusing, actions that contravene current regulations.
Conclusions: Occupational exposure to pesticides in the studied population is high and poorly regulated. Technical training programs, access to complete personal protective equipment, and monitoring of regulatory compliance are needed to reduce risks to health and the environment.
